I have a My Book for Mac that I had been using to back up files on my old macbook. The problem is my macbook has pretty much died. It can no longer be updated and freezes just after start up.

I have a Windows laptop. I want to know if it is possible to gain access to the back up files. I am particularly interested in the itunes library.

It would depend on the current file system of your unit. Out of the box, the WD My Book for Mac comes HFS+, which is a Mac-optimized file system that is incompatible with Windows. On the other hand, if your hard drive had been formatted to FAT32 at some point you would only need to connect your unit.

If not, you will need an application able to grant access to Mac-formatted hard drives in Windows.
